Abstract
The invention discloses broiler chicken anti-stress health-care drinking water. The health-care drinking water comprises the components and contents per 1000 L: 1-28 g of a yeast extract, 1-12 g of yeasts, 1-16 g of a plant extract, 10-15 g of lactic acid, 1-16 g of lactate, 3-8 g of citric acid, 2-15 g of citrate, 1-5 g of phosphoric acid, and 5-20 g of propylene glycol. The broiler chicken anti-stress health-care drinking water is stable and uniform, has no precipitates, does not generate delamination, has no corrosiveness, has higher buffer capacity, and allows broiler chicken gastrointestinal tracts to maintain a stable acidic environment. The broiler chicken anti-stress health-care drinking water enables broiler chicken intestinal tracts to maintain a lower pH value, inhibits proliferation of intestinal harmful bacteria, provides nutrient substances for proliferation of beneficial bacteria, improves broiler chicken immunity and anti-stress ability, rapidly repairs damaged organs, improves broiler chicken health, reduces the death rate, and improves broiler chicken production performance and economic benefits.

Background technology
Under current intensive farm environment, broiler chicken is often in stress situation, as immunological stress, disease stress, cold and hot stress, crowded stress, transport stress etc., cause growth of meat chicken speed slack-off, immunity degradation, M & M improves.At present mainly by feed control technique alleviate stress, as added the functional additives such as vitamin and amino acid in feed, but because broiler chicken feed intake when the stress situation can sharply reduce, so effect is not satisfactory.
Broiler chicken amount of drinking water under stress situation is constant or increase, therefore by drinking-water, add functional additive alleviate broiler chicken stress effect obviously better than adding in feed, but the subject matter wherein existing is exactly the water-soluble not good of some composition, if prepare improper precipitation or the lamination of being prone to.
Summary of the invention
The object of the present invention is to provide a kind of broiler chicken anti-stress health-care drinking water.
Technical scheme of the present invention is achieved in the following ways:
An anti-stress health-care drinking water, in every 1000L health-care drinking-water, the content of each composition is respectively: yeast extract 1~28g, saccharomycete 1~12g, plant extracts 1~16g, lactic acid 10~15g, lactate 1~16g, citric acid 3~8g, citrate 2~15g, phosphatase 11~5g, propane diols 5~20g.
Further, described yeast extract is yellow to brown transparency liquid, and wherein amino acid content is more than 20%, and total protein is more than 40%, and pH value is 4~7.
Further, described saccharomycete is solubility unartificial yeast powder, viable count>=1.5 * 10
10individual/g.
Further, any one or the two kind mixing of described plant extracts in astragalus polyose, betaine.
Further, described lactate is solubility lactate.
Further, described lactate is any one or the two kinds of mixing in zinc lactate, calcium lactate.
Further, described citrate is solubility citrate, is selected from any one or a few in potassium citrate, natrium citricum, calcium citrate and mixes.
The present invention also provides the preparation method of above-mentioned broiler chicken anti-stress health-care drinking water, the steps include: to take in proportion lactic acid, lactate, citric acid, citrate, phosphoric acid, propane diols, yeast extract, saccharomycete and plant extracts, add successively in the water of certain volume and fully and stir, until dissolve completely.
The present invention also provides the using method of above-mentioned broiler chicken anti-stress health-care drinking water, the steps include: that this drinking water freely drinks 5 days after chick hatching, then in vaccine inoculation, turn group and the front and back of reloading are respectively drunk 2 days, before delivering for sale, drink 3 days; Also drinkable under stress situation at broiler chicken, drink continuously 5 days at every turn.
Beneficial effect of the present invention is:
(1), without precipitation, there is not layering in stable, the homogeneous of broiler chicken anti-stress health-care drinking water of the present invention, non-corrosiveness, and there is higher buffer capacity, make broiler chicken intestines and stomach keep stable sour environment.
(2) broiler chicken anti-stress health-care drinking water of the present invention can make Intestine of Broiler keep lower pH value, the propagation that suppresses harmful intestinal tract bacteria, for beneficial bacterium propagation provides nutriment, improve immunity of meat chickens and anti-stress ability, repair fast damaged organ, improve broiler health, reduce death rate, improve meat chicken production performance and economic benefit.

In order to verify the effect of broiler chicken anti-stress health-care drinking water, the broiler chicken anti-stress health-care drinking water that embodiment 1-7 is prepared carries out feeding experiment.20000 1d kind broiler chicken are divided into 8 groups at random, every group 2500: control group is drinking public water supply always, embodiment 1-7 group 1~5d, vaccine inoculation, turn group and reload before and after 2 days and deliver for sale before within 3 days, drink the prepared health-care drinking-water of embodiment 1-7, other times drinking public water supply.Broiler chicken is raised in closed hen house, free choice feeding and drinking-water, and illumination 24 hours every days, feeding and management is carried out routinely.Feeding of broiler off-test when going on the market, 54 days by a definite date.In test the 7th, 21, choose at random 50 during 54d and take out title, take out claim 5 times after calculating mean value, the dead number of washing in a pan of record every day, calculates average weight and survival rate.Result as shown in Table 1 and Table 2, embodiment 1-7 group 7,21,54d body weight and survival rate be all higher than control group, proves that broiler chicken anti-stress health-care drinking water of the present invention can reduce broiler chicken death, improves growth of meat chicken speed.
In embodiment 1-7, plant extracts adopts any one in astragalus polyose, betaine, or the arbitrary composition of two kinds (arbitrary proportion), and result of the test is basic identical.
In embodiment 1-7, lactate adopts any one in zinc lactate, calcium lactate, or the arbitrary composition of two kinds (arbitrary proportion), and result of the test is basic identical.
In embodiment 1-7, citrate adopts any one in potassium citrate, natrium citricum, calcium citrate, or the composition of any two kinds (arbitrary proportion), or potassium citrate, natrium citricum and calcium citrate compositions (arbitrary proportion), result of the test is basic identical.
The impact of table 1 broiler chicken anti-stress health-care of the present invention drinking water on broiler weight (g)
Age in days | Control group | Embodiment 1 | Embodiment 2 | Embodiment 3 | Embodiment 4 | Embodiment 5 | Embodiment 6 | Embodiment 7 |
7d | 120 | 150 | 160 | 135 | 136 | 159 | 161 | 165 |
21d | 450 | 500 | 520 | 470 | 472 | 521 | 520 | 525 |
54d | 1850 | 2150 | 2210 | 2200 | 2201 | 2211 | 2209 | 2250 |
The impact of table 2 broiler chicken anti-stress health-care of the present invention drinking water on broiler chicken survival rate (%)
Age in days | Control group | Embodiment 1 | Embodiment 2 | Embodiment 3 | Embodiment 4 | Embodiment 5 | Embodiment 6 | Embodiment 7 |
7d | 99.66 | 99.80 | 99.83 | 99.72 | 99.72 | 99.83 | 99.84 | 99.85 |
21d | 98.05 | 98.43 | 98.50 | 98.20 | 98.22 | 98.50 | 98.50 | 98.56 |
54d | 95.27 | 97.56 | 97.72 | 96.76 | 96.77 | 97.71 | 97.73 | 97.78 |
